Maybe some clothing?

In all seriousness though
alcohol wipes,
a light blanket,
a jacket that would be suitable for 35 and above,
Gloves,
tissues,
2 or 3 cases of of water
Fix a flat
a rain pancho
2 pillows one for your lower back one for your neck (while sleeping in the 8)
a box of granola/protein bars
Gatorade and water are your friend,

when you fill up at gas stations stretch your legs each time.

I would save space and bring 2 jack stands.
try to stay away from using AC,
stay away from energy drinks,

I drive cross country allot and I always find myself in weird places and situations. one time I got stuck going up a mountain in Colorado. luckily I brought stock tires (on my 300zx) swapped them out in the middle of a storm and got down the mountain safely. Ive also overheated/car randomly stalled in Baker in 108 degree weather, luckily I had 4 gallons of water with me.

In September when you cross Colorado you will hit around 33-35 degree temps at night. In Vegas you'll hot around 90. I basically like to be prepared in case i get stuck in my car for a long period of time for any reason.

With that said pack light. Like the oil 12-15 qts might be a bit overkill, id bring enough for one oil change.

Just be prepared. and try and hit southern Utah during the day time or sunset its beautiful.
